Логические элементы. Карты Карно. Триггеры. Регистры. Счетчики. Запоминающие устройства ЭВМ, страница 2

Управление ведется по заднему фронту.

Синхронный T – триггер

Строится на базе двухтактных RS – триггерах.

Функциональная схема синхронного RS – триггера:

В данной схеме присутствует так называемый вход синхронизации C.

Для двухтактного синхронного RS –триггера управление ведется по заднему фронту входа синхронизации и смена сигнала на входе триггера происходит только в том случае если значение счетного входа равно 1-це, если T=0, то смена состояния триггера на происходит.

D – триггер (триггер с задержкой по времени)

Асинхронные D –триггеры являются повторительными, поэтому для практической реализации функции с задержкой времени используются однотактные и двухтактные D –триггеры.


Управление ведется по переднему фронту единичного сигнала входа синхронизации. Максимальная задержка сигнала однотактного D – триггера на выходе  сигнала на входе.

Двухтактный синхронный D – триггер отличается от однотактного тем, что задержка по времени на Т.

JK – триггер (универсальный)

Может реализовывать все функции предыдущих триггеров.

Главное отличие JK – триггера: не имеет запрещенных состояний.

1 – хранение 0-я;

2 – подтверждение 0-я;

3 – установка 1-цы;

4 – переход в противоположное состояние;

5 – хранение 1-цы;

6 – переход в 0-ое состояние;

7 – подтверждение 1-цы;

8 – переход в противоположное состояние;

Карта Карно для JK – триггера:

                     

Сигнал на выходе триггера в последующий момент времени изменяется на противоположный, если J=1, или равен предыдущему если K=0, если J=K=1, то триггер работает в режиме счетного триггера, если размыкается обратная связь, то триггер работает в режиме синхронного RS – триггера, если на J и K одновременно подавать противоположные сигналы, то триггер работает в режиме D – триггера.

Незадействованные входы элементов & являются свободными для наращивания схемы.

Вопросы для самопроверки

1.  Что такое триггер.

2.  Работа RS –триггера.

3.  Переключательная функция для элементов И-НЕ.

4.  Переключательная функция для элементов ИЛИ-НЕ.

5.  Функциональная схема и работа Д –триггера.

6.  Функциональная схема и работа Т-триггера

7.  Функциональная схема и работа JK- триггера

          ЛЕКЦИЯ № 3

РЕГИСТРЫ

Цель. Изучить работу и принципы построения регистров.

Задачи:

1.  Изучить принципы построения регистров.

2.  Изучить функциональные схемы регистров.

Регистр – этот узел ЭВМ предназначенный для хранения кода слова, и выполнения над хранимым словом ряда операций.

Количество разрядов регистра зависит от количества триггеров входящих в его состав.

Операции выполняемые в регистре:

ü Установка регистра в 0-ое состояние;

ü Сдвиг кода слова;

ü Передача кода слова из одного регистра в другой.

Типы регистров:

ü Параллельный регистр – предназначен для хранения кода слова, и передача слова в другой регистр;

ü Последовательный регистр – предназначен для последовательного сдвига слова влево или вправо;

Функциональная схема трехразрядного параллельного регистра, на базе однотактных  D – триггерах.

Данный регистр носит название однофазного регистра, т.к. запись слова происходит по одному информационному входу «V».

Время обработки регистра:

Тртр&

Ттр – время срабатывания триггера

Т& – время срабатывания элемента &

Трехразрядный, параллельный, парафазный регистр на синхронном RS – триггере

Каждый разряд данного регистра определяется 2-я информационными входами R и S, которые являются взаимно-инвертирован-ными, что приводит к однозначности при установке триггера. И для увеличения быстродействия необходимо выполнение равенства:

Тртр – время срабатывания триггера равно времени срабатывания регистра.

Пример передачи кода слова между двумя, двухразрядными, параллельными и парафазными регистрами.

Если V=1, происходит запись в первый регистр. Если V=0, происходит передача слова во второй регистр.

Трехразрядный последовательный сдвигающий регистр построенный на синхронных D – триггерах

R – установка триггеров в 0-ое состояние

ОС – обратная связь.

С – номер такта, Q0,Q1,Q2 – входы регистра.

При каждом тактовом импульсе происходит сдвиг кода слова вправо.

Для сохранения информации в регистре при ее передачи в другой регистр вводится обратная связь, и вместе с записью информации в следующий регистр происходит восстановление информации в исходный регистр.

Сдвигающие регистры могут быть реверсивными, т.е. осуществлять сдвиг информации как влево так и вправо в зависимости от сигнала в цепи управления.

Двухразрядный реверсивный сдвигающий регистр

Если V=1, происходит запись слова в разряды регистра. При Е=1 осуществляется сдвиг слова вправо, если Е=0 сдвиг слова влево.

Q0 – информационный выход при сдвиге слова влево

Q1 – информационный выход при сдвиге слова вправо

Если осуществляется сдвиг слова вправо используется информационный вход Х1, если влево используется информационный вход Х2.

Универсальный последовательный параллельный регистр (5 элементов 2-И-ИЛИ, 4 синхронных D – триггера)

При последовательном режиме работы регистра вход V=1, и код слова последовательно через вход D поступает в триггеры.

Входные сигналы b0…b3 являются информационными входными сигналами для триггеров и зависят от выхода триггера предыдущего разряда (предыдущего триггера).